The Beauty of Ginkakuji Temple
Ginkakuji Temple, often called the Silver Pavilion, is a gem nestled in the lush landscapes of Kyoto. This stunning temple captures the essence of Japanese Zen architecture, boasting a serene atmosphere that invites reflection.
Its beautifully manicured gardens, adorned with raked gravel and moss, create a perfect backdrop for photos. Visitors can’t help but admire the contrast of the weathered wooden structures against the vibrant greenery.
Each corner reveals a new perspective, making it a photographer’s paradise. Ginkakuji isn’t just a feast for the eyes; it’s a peaceful retreat where one can truly appreciate the beauty of nature and tradition.

Accessibility and Health Considerations
Exploring Ginkakuji Temple is a delightful experience, but it’s important to keep accessibility and health considerations in mind.
This beautiful location isn’t wheelchair accessible, so those with mobility issues should plan accordingly. The temple’s pathways can be uneven and steep, making it tricky for individuals with back problems, pregnant travelers, or anyone with serious health conditions.
However, it’s conveniently near public transportation, making access easier for most. With these factors in mind, most travelers can enjoy the tour without a hitch.

Exploring the Surroundings
How can one truly appreciate the beauty of Ginkakuji Temple without taking a moment to explore its surroundings? The tranquil gardens, lined with meticulously pruned trees and vibrant moss, invite visitors to stroll and reflect.
Nearby, the Philosopher’s Path offers a serene walk along a cherry blossom-lined canal, perfect for snapping Instagram-worthy pics. Don’t miss the small tea houses and local shops selling unique crafts and snacks.
Each corner of the area tells a story, enhancing the temple’s rich history. So, take a bit of time, breathe in the fresh air, and soak up the peaceful vibes that Kyoto has to offer.
